The Unique Scheduling Challenges of Learning Centers

Learning centers in Elk Grove face distinctive scheduling complexities that set them apart from other small businesses. Managing these challenges effectively requires specialized solutions that address the educational environment’s unique demands. From coordinating multiple instructors with varying specialties to accommodating students’ ever-changing availability, learning centers must navigate a complex web of scheduling considerations.

  • Variable Session Lengths: Unlike standard business appointments, learning centers must schedule sessions of different durations—from 30-minute skill assessments to 3-hour intensive study groups.
  • Student-Instructor Matching: Pairing students with the right instructors based on subject expertise, teaching style, and personality fit requires sophisticated scheduling logic.
  • Resource Management: Classroom space, specialized equipment, and educational materials must be allocated efficiently across multiple concurrent sessions.
  • Seasonal Fluctuations: Learning centers experience significant enrollment shifts around school calendars, requiring flexible scheduling approaches for seasonal demand.
  • Last-Minute Changes: Student cancellations and instructor availability changes require quick rescheduling capabilities to avoid lost revenue and educational disruptions.
  • Parent Communication: Keeping parents informed about schedule changes, upcoming sessions, and student progress necessitates integrated communication tools.

Essential Features of Scheduling Software for Learning Centers

When selecting scheduling software for an Elk Grove learning center, owners should prioritize solutions with features specifically designed for educational environments. The right system will address both administrative efficiency and educational effectiveness. As learning centers expand their service offerings, their scheduling needs become increasingly sophisticated, requiring a robust platform that can grow alongside the business.

  • Calendar Synchronization: Integration with popular calendar platforms like Google Calendar and Outlook ensures instructors and administrative staff maintain synchronized schedules across all devices.
  • Student Profile Management: Comprehensive profiles tracking academic progress, learning styles, and attendance history help match students with appropriate instructors and programs.
  • Automated Reminders: Reduce no-shows and late cancellations with automated text and email notifications to students and parents about upcoming sessions.
  • Resource Allocation: Ensure classrooms, equipment, and materials are efficiently assigned without double-booking through intelligent resource management features.
  • Self-Service Booking: Empower parents and students to book, reschedule, or cancel sessions online, reducing administrative workload while improving customer satisfaction.
  • Recurring Appointment Setting: Easily schedule regular weekly sessions for ongoing programs and automatically adjust for holidays and special events.

Optimizing Staff Scheduling for Educational Effectiveness

Effective instructor scheduling directly impacts educational outcomes at learning centers. In Elk Grove’s competitive educational market, centers that optimize their instructor scheduling gain advantages in both teaching quality and operational efficiency. Strategic staff scheduling allows learning centers to maximize their instructors’ strengths while providing a consistent, high-quality experience for students.

  • Skill-Based Assignments: Match instructors to students based on subject expertise, teaching approach, and demonstrated success with similar learning profiles.
  • Workload Balancing: Prevent instructor burnout by distributing teaching hours appropriately and avoiding back-to-back intensive sessions without adequate breaks.
  • Continuity Planning: Maintain educational continuity by scheduling the same instructors with students throughout a program while having qualified substitutes identified.
  • Credential Tracking: Ensure instructors’ certifications and credentials remain current with automated reminders for renewals and continuing education requirements.
  • Performance Optimization: Schedule instructors during their peak performance hours when possible, recognizing that teaching effectiveness can vary throughout the day.

Ensuring Compliance and Security in Educational Scheduling

Learning centers handle sensitive student information that requires proper protection. Scheduling systems must incorporate robust security features and compliance capabilities to safeguard this data while meeting educational regulatory requirements. For Elk Grove learning centers, maintaining compliance isn’t just about avoiding penalties—it’s about building trust with families and protecting their business reputation.

  • Data Privacy Protections: Ensure scheduling systems comply with relevant data protection regulations, including proper handling of minor students’ information.
  • Role-Based Access Controls: Limit data visibility based on staff roles, ensuring instructors only see information relevant to their students and responsibilities.
  • Secure Communication Channels: Utilize encrypted messaging for sharing sensitive student information with parents and other authorized stakeholders.
  • Audit Trails: Maintain detailed logs of schedule changes, access to student records, and administrative actions for accountability and compliance verification.
  • Payment Security: Ensure integrated payment processing meets PCI DSS standards to protect financial information and prevent fraud.

Learning centers should select scheduling systems that prioritize data privacy and security while offering features that facilitate regulatory compliance. Compliance features should include capabilities for maintaining required documentation, generating regulatory reports, and implementing age-appropriate safeguards for minors. Implementation Best Practices for Learning Centers

Successfully implementing a new scheduling system requires careful planning and execution. For Elk Grove learning centers, the transition to a new scheduling solution represents a significant operational change that affects staff, students, and parents. Following implementation best practices helps ensure a smooth transition with minimal disruption to educational services.

  • Needs Assessment: Begin with a thorough evaluation of your specific scheduling requirements, identifying pain points in current processes and establishing clear objectives for the new system.
  • Stakeholder Involvement: Include representatives from all user groups—administrative staff, instructors, and even parent representatives—in the selection and implementation process.
  • Data Migration Planning: Develop a comprehensive strategy for transferring existing schedule data, student information, and historical records to the new system.
  • Phased Implementation: Consider a gradual rollout approach, perhaps starting with administrative users before extending to instructors and finally to parent/student access.
  • Comprehensive Training: Provide role-specific training for all system users, including hands-on practice sessions and accessible reference materials.

Learning centers should also establish clear success metrics to evaluate the implementation’s effectiveness. These metrics might include adoption rates, time savings, error reduction, or user satisfaction scores. Ongoing support and training are equally important, as users will discover new questions and challenges as they become more familiar with the system. Many learning centers find that designating internal “super users” who receive advanced training helps provide day-to-day assistance to colleagues while reducing dependency on external support resources.
